Account Code Entry, Forced
The system does not check the validity of account codes. It checks only for the proper
number of digits or the code terminator #.
Calls that do not require FACE can still be assigned an account code, as in previous releases
of System 25.
Refer to the “Account Code Entry, Optional” feature description in this
manual for the procedures.
Interactions
The following features interact with Forced Account Code Entry.
Bridging of System Access Buttons: Calls made from Bridged Access (BA) buttons on a
bridging station follow the FACE restrictions of the bridging station, not of the associated
principal station.
Call Accountability: The account code entry may be made before or after the Call
Accountability entry. Dial tone is returned to the user after either entry.
Callback Queuing: An account code entered before queuing is saved for SMDR.
Conference: Calls can be conference in both directions between a FACE-restricted station
and a non-FACE station.
Display: When a user activates the Forced Account Code Entry feature by dialing ✶ 0, the
system displays the prompt ACCT?. As the user enters the account code, the digits are
displayed to the right of the prompt.
If the number of digits exceeds 9, the system
automatically scrolls to Screen 2; the continuation character “-” and the remaining digits
appear on Screen 2.
The prompt and digits remain displayed until one of the following occurs:
— The user enters either “#” or the administered number of code digits.
— The user restarts the Account Code Entry feature by dialing ✶ 0 to correct an
erroneous entry.
— The system time-out for Account Code Entry is reached.
— The user selects another button that overwrites the display.
Forwarding: Stations with FACE administered for all calls cannot forward calls to any
outside numbers. Stations with FACE administered for “dial 0 or 1” calls can forward calls
to any outside number except for “dial 0 or 1” numbers.
Intercept Treatment with Reorder Tone: The user receives reorder tone when an account
code is required on a call but is not entered.
Last Number Dialed: The access code ✶ 0 and the account code are not stored by this
feature.
